How To Choose a Gutter Installer

Doing comprehensive research on gutter companies ahead of time helps avoid shoddy workmanship and overinflated rates. When assessing gutter installers, look for:

Assess Their Experience

Seek out local gutter companies that have been in operation for many years or decades. Providers with this level of experience are familiar with local weather and climate patterns as well as popular architecture styles, which helps them properly analyze your needs and get you the best gutters for your home. Usually, extensive experience also means proven techniques for safe, efficient gutter installation.

Verify Proper Licensing and Insurance

When picking a company, make sure that it has the proper credentials. Ask to see licensing, bonding, and insurance documentation prior to signing a contract. Proper certification and insurance mean that the company is legitimate and that you'll avoid issues if property damage or an injury occurs during the project.

Check Reviews and Referrals

Browse online reviews on sites like Google, Yelp, and the Better Business Bureau. Check that the company has a record of excellent work and good customer service. Look for satisfied longstanding customers to gain insights into a provider’s reliability. Be on the lookout for red flags, like poor communication or unfinished jobs. All our recommended providers boast a good average rating across a high number of reviews.

Choose Reputable Brands

Look for a gutter installer that's officially certified by the manufacturer. This way, you’ll have a provider you can trust that's trained to install your gutters per the manufacturer's specifications. This helps ensure the best results.

Examine Warranties

Only use providers that offer strong manufacturer guarantees on supplies as well as their own installation guarantees. Look for 5 to 10 year warranties on basic aluminum gutters and 1-3 years on labor.

Gutter Installation Materials

Look for long-lasting, durable materials such as heavy gauge aluminum that are unlikely to rust, warp, or decay over time. The right materials will hold up under your local weather in Fairmount. You'll want to make certain that any paints and finishes also have a long lifespan and don't peel or fade prematurely.

Questions to Ask

When comparing potential gutter installation providers, you should ask a number of detailed questions:

  • What steps do you take to ensure my new gutters have the optimal slope and pitch to avoid standing water? Correct slope and pitch significantly diminish overflow risk. Your gutter installation professional should know how to properly align a gutter system on your roof.
  • How will you make sure there’s smooth integration with my current roofing? Find out whether the company includes steps like underlayment replacement.
  • How long does the installation process take? Most companies can complete a gutter installation project in around one day's time.
  • What kind of warranties are there for materials and labor? High-quality materials are often backed by 5–10 year warranties. Labor is usually back by a 1-3 year warranty.
  • What materials are recommended for my gutters based on my specific home style and the local weather conditions? Consider the advantages and disadvantages of each gutter material, accounting for important factors such as Fairmount's typical rainfall, snowfall, and the weight and volume of the gutters.
  • Will you give me a detailed quote for both problem area fixes and full gutter replacement? Get quotes in writing from providers, so you know exactly what the price of gutter installation will be before the work begins.
  • Can you also install gutter guards? Gutter guards help prevent blockages that occur due to leaves, twigs, and other debris falling into your gutters.
Putting in the work to vet companies thoroughly will help you find the right gutter installation company for your home's needs. Investing in new gutters helps avoid much more costly water and structural damage later on.

Frequently Asked Questions About Gutters in Fairmount, KS

One way to verify the legitimacy of a gutter services company is to look for online reviews. When you speak to a company representative, verify that they have insurance and that they can clearly explain how the job will or won't affect your roof warranty. Last but not least, a reliable Fairmount gutter services company should provide an estimate and a copy of their warranties to you in writing after performing an inspection.

The average Fairmount homeowner spends between $402-$3,504 for gutter installation, with a cost of about $3.89 per linear foot. This cost is influenced by the size of your house (including number of stories) and the gutter materials and whether you’ve opted for seamless or sectional. The best way to determine how much gutter installation will cost is to reach out to one or more Fairmount gutter installation companies and ask. Make sure to have a general idea of the material and gutter footage you want when you call.

Working with a gutter professional in Fairmount gives you higher quality work, improved safety, and lower risk of future issues. When you're installing or replacing your gutter system, a gutter services professional can provide a warranty for materials and services. If it's time to replace your existing gutters, a gutter services company will provide materials and haul away any leftover materials or debris afterward. This will save both time and hassle, and help you keep your lawn clean.

A properly cared for gutter system should last approximately 20 years, or up to 50 year if your gutters are copper. The actual frequency with which your gutters need to be replaced depends on several factors, such as the material of the gutters, how well your system is taken care of, and the weather in your area of Kansas.

Make sure to inspect and clean your gutters on a regular basis to prevent buildup of debris, which can clog, crack, or strain your gutters. If a problem arises, make sure to address it as soon as possible, either on your own or by hiring a Fairmount gutter services company. Finally, you can add gutter guards to your existing gutter system, which will reduce the frequency of cleaning and maintenance.

If your area gets the occasional heavy rainstorm, or if you want to consolidate runoff from multiple gutters, you might want to consider adding one or more conductor heads to your gutter system. These wider sections give your gutters more time to drain without overflowing. Depending on the overhang of your roof, you might consider using a drain chain to help your gutters drain. Rain chains drain water directly to the ground, similar to a downspout, and can be good for houses with deeper overhangs. Accessories such as fascia brackets, decorative boots, and downspout brackets can enhance the look of your gutter system.
